Hello, fellow Long Islander! I assume you are talking about booking a Southwest flight. If you get a Ding fare that is lower you can re-book and use the credit within a year of when the original tickets were purchased. If you re-book by the end of this year anyone can use the credit. After January 1, it can only be used by the original passenger.
